Head of Operations Job at Edgewood Consulting Limited

Edgewood Consulting Limited - Our client, a Microfinance Bank based in Okitipupa Environ, Ondo State, is recruiting to fill the position below:

Job Position: Head of Operations

Job Location: Okitipupa, Ondo
Employment Type: Full-time

Job Summary

  • The Head of Operations is responsible for cash management, loan processing and disbursement, customer service, risk management, and compliance with regulations.
  • The role holder will oversee the work of the operations team and develop and implement policies and procedures to ensure the smooth and efficient operation of the bank.

Specific Responsibilities


  • Assist with internal, external, and regulatory audits and examinations
  • Oversee the overall operations of the Micro-financebank, including cash management, loan processing and disbursement, customer service, risk management, and compliance with regulations.
  • Responsible for effectiveness and efficiency of the branches, team development, team morale, and implementation of micro-finance code of conduct at the various levels of operations.
  • Develop strategies to minimize customer complaints and suggest ways of managing the public image of the Company.
  • Liaise with the Finance Team to ensure timely preparations of annual budget, quarterly budget review, forecasts, and business plans.
  • Provide advice on all operation issues.
  • Appraise the operational system in place and monitor the implementation of the Company’s operation manuals, making appropriate recommendations regarding the need for change.
  • Any other duties and responsibilities that may be assigned from time to meet the objectives of the Company.
  • Other duties as assigned by the Managing Director.

Technical Knowledge / Minimum Requirements

  • A minimum of First Degree or its equivalent in any Business-related discipline.
  • A minimum of 7 years of post-graduation experience out of which, at least, 4 must have been in the financial services industry.
  • Evidence that the candidate possesses proven skills and competencies in practical Microfinance banking
  • has undergone the Microfinance Certification Programme and obtained a Certificate in Microfinance Banking issued by the Chartered Institute of Bankers of Nigeria (CIBN).
  • Possess experience in innovative payment mechanisms and understand Fin-tech laws and regulations in Nigeria
  • Excel in working relationships with the banks and regulators
  • Possess high level of trust to drive best practices with minimal supervision
  • Have outstanding project management and leadership skills
  • Have a strong business acumen and problem-solving ability
  • Possess excellent analytical skills, in-depth understanding of business models.
  • Good understanding of CBN / NIDC and other regulatory landscape.
